Haiti - Weather : Serious floods in the North and in the Nippes (provisional report)

The Departmental Technical Coordination of the North and the Nippes of the Civil Protection inform us that the torrential rains which fell during the weekend of December 6 to 8 caused serious floods in their respective department, in particular in the communes of : Cap-Haïtien, Limonade, Quartier-Morin, Grande-Rivière du Nord, Bahon, Acul-du-Nord, Plaine-du-Nord, Port-Magot, Borgne, Limbé and Baradères.

Partial balance sheet :

Cap-Haitien :

Part of the barrière bouteille sub-commissariat collapsed following a landslide at the Labory Moose. Floods noted at the localities located on the bed of the Haut-du-Cap River (Blue-Hills, Bas Zo Vincent, Champin, Cité du peuple, and Shadda) causing losses to homes, filth and alluvium obstruct certain streets of Downtown.

Borgne :

A young man in his twenties was swept away by the raging waters, his body was found;

Limonade :

In the communal section of Basse Plaine, specific to Bord-de-Mer, several localities are flooded but the population is out of danger at the moment;

Grande-rivière du Nord, Bahon, Acul-du-Nord, Plaine-du-Nord, Limbé et Port-Magot, Quartier-Morin, Clerisse et Baudin :

Several hundred families are stricken.

Baradères :

A flash flood caused a flood of the town, particularly affecting:

  • La Rue Désaubert

  • La Rue St François

  • La Rue St Augustin

  • Cité St-Pierre

  • Quartier bas Cimetière

  • Quartier Ville neuve

The first provisional assessment amounts to 315 affected families.

The two coordinations continue with the surveillance and keep the permanent contact with the Direction of the Civil Protection (DPC) which reiterates its commitment to accompany the population. The DPC once again reminds people in areas at risk of floods, landslides to remain vigilant and adhere to the usual safety guidelines in case of heavy rain and gusts of wind.
